No luck. I also noticed another strange issue. Looks like lsusb is giving me 2 different product ids at different times.

Bus 001 Device 002: ID 106c:3b05 Curitel Communications, Inc.

Bus 001 Device 004: ID 106c:3716 Curitel Communications, Inc.

It seems like the first one is the hard drive device and the second is the modem. Does that indicate that the usb_modeswitch isn't working?

Try Sakis3g. It has been the easiest way to make wireless 3g connections for me:

http://www.sakis3g.org/

Get the Full version, not the binary free version, if you don't want to install and mess with usbmodeswitch yourself.
